Understanding that Ripple Ecosystem and XRP
The Ripple ecosystem is a complex and dynamic network of technologies and applications built around the native copyright, XRP. XRP serves as a facilitator for fast and cost-effective cross-border payments, leveraging Ripple's distributed ledger. The ecosystem includes a range of products and services, including RippleNet, a global network of financial institutions that utilize XRP for payment processing. Developers can also engage with the Ripple ecosystem by building applications on top of its open-source platform. Understanding the intricacies of the Ripple ecosystem and XRP is essential for anyone interested in exploring the future of finance.

From Ledger to Liquidity: Exploring the World of XRP
XRP functions as a digital asset and native copyright within the blockchain known as Ripple.
Launched in 2012, XRP has gained traction for its fast transaction times. It aims to streamline cross-border payments and delivers a stable platform for global financial movements.
The Ripple network utilizes XRP to mediate transactions between users, reducing the need for middlemen and accelerating payment processing.
